From b72040daad03686318c227f3d40c4cd12e9d9eb4 Mon Sep 17 00:00:00 2001 From: Michael Niedermayer Date: Thu, 3 Oct 2013 16:59:11 +0200 Subject: [PATCH] ffplay: avoid direct access to max_lowres use av_codec_get_max_lowres() This avoids future ABI issues when the field is moved to the end of the struct. Reviewed-by: Marton Balint Signed-off-by: Michael Niedermayer --- ffplay.c |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) diff --git a/ffplay.c b/ffplay.c index 4d89c02b2a..e3f5062d98 100644 --- a/ffplay.c +++ b/ffplay.c @@ -2496,10 +2496,10 @@ static int stream_component_open(VideoState *is, int stream_index) avctx->codec_id = codec->id; avctx->workaround_bugs = workaround_bugs; avctx->lowres = lowres; - if(avctx->lowres > codec->max_lowres){ + if(avctx->lowres > av_codec_get_max_lowres(codec)){ av_log(avctx, AV_LOG_WARNING, "The maximum value for lowres supported by the decoder is %d\n", - codec->max_lowres); - avctx->lowres= codec->max_lowres; + av_codec_get_max_lowres(codec)); + avctx->lowres= av_codec_get_max_lowres(codec); } avctx->error_concealment = error_concealment;